Any of the OE replacement discs from a reputable maker like Pagid etc will be absolutely fine, no need to pay rip off BMW prices for discs when they are probably made in China too.
eurocarparts.com is the best bet IMO. Also you need to change pads with the discs and get new wear sensors.

When you get slight brake judder it can be just pad transfer build up. To resolve this it requires 3 heavy high speed stops and this will solve the problem in most cases.
